Code C1416 2018 Toyota RAV4 Description

The C1416 diagnostic trouble code (DTC) for a 2018 Toyota RAV4 indicates a Rear Speed Sensor Left Output Malfunction. This code specifically points to an issue with the rear left wheel speed sensor, which is responsible for monitoring the speed of the wheel and sending this information to the vehicle's anti-lock braking system (ABS) and traction control system. The speed sensor plays a crucial role in ensuring the proper functioning of these safety systems by providing real-time data on wheel speed, allowing the vehicle to adjust braking force and traction control as needed.

Common Causes of C1416 2018 Toyota RAV4

  1. Damaged or worn rear left wheel speed sensor.
  2. Corrosion or debris affecting the sensor's performance.
  3. Faulty wiring or connectors leading to the sensor.
  4. Issues with the ABS or traction control module.
  5. Electronic control unit (ECU) malfunctions affecting sensor communication.

Symptoms of C1416 2018 Toyota RAV4

  1. Illumination of the ABS warning light on the dashboard.
  2. Traction control system engaging unexpectedly or not functioning properly.
  3. Increased stopping distances or difficulty braking.
  4. Uneven braking or pulling to one side during braking.
  5. ABS system activating unnecessarily or inconsistently.

How to Fix C1416 2018 Toyota RAV4

  1. Begin by diagnosing the specific cause of the rear speed sensor left output malfunction using a diagnostic scanner to retrieve the trouble codes.
  2. Inspect the rear left wheel speed sensor for any physical damage, corrosion, or debris that may be affecting its performance.
  3. Check the wiring and connectors leading to the sensor for any signs of damage or loose connections.
  4. Replace the rear left wheel speed sensor if it is found to be faulty, ensuring proper installation and calibration.
  5. Clear the DTCs from the vehicle's ECU and perform a test drive to verify that the issue has been resolved and that the ABS and traction control systems are functioning correctly.

Cost to Fix C1416 2018 Toyota RAV4

The typical repair costs for addressing a rear speed sensor left output malfunction on a 2018 Toyota RAV4 can vary depending on the specific cause of the issue and the cost of parts and labor. In general, replacing a wheel speed sensor can range from $100 to $300, with additional costs for diagnostic time, labor, and any necessary calibration. Overall, the total repair cost for this issue may fall within the range of $200 to $500, but it is advisable to check with local auto repair shops for more accurate estimates based on your location and vehicle specifics. Keep in mind that labor rates can vary widely, with hourly rates typically ranging from $80 to $150 at most auto repair shops.

Tech Notes for C1416 2018 Toyota RAV4

Because the Rear Axle Hub and Bearing Assembly cannot be disassembled, if the Rear Speed Sensor needs replacement, replace the Rear Axle Hub and Bearing Assembly.

Frequently Asked Questions about C1416 2018 Toyota RAV4 Code

1. What are common symptoms of OBDII code C1416 on a 2018 Toyota RAV4?

The common symptoms of code C1416 include the ABS warning light illuminating on the dashboard, potential traction control issues, and possible loss of stability control.

2. What does the OBDII code C1416 indicate in a 2018 Toyota RAV4?

Code C1416 indicates a Rear Speed Sensor Left Output Malfunction in the 2018 Toyota RAV4's anti-lock braking system.

3. What are the possible causes of OBDII code C1416 on a 2018 Toyota RAV4?

Possible causes of code C1416 include a faulty rear left speed sensor, damaged wiring or connectors in the sensor circuit, or issues with the ABS control module.

4. How can I diagnose OBDII code C1416 on my 2018 Toyota RAV4?

Diagnosing code C1416 involves visually inspecting the rear left speed sensor and its wiring for any visible damage, testing the sensor's output using a multimeter, and scanning the ABS system for any related fault codes.

5. Can I continue driving my 2018 Toyota RAV4 with OBDII code C1416?

It is not recommended to continue driving with code C1416 present, as it can affect the proper functioning of the ABS system and compromise vehicle safety.

6. How can I repair OBDII code C1416 on my 2018 Toyota RAV4?

Repairing code C1416 typically involves replacing the rear left speed sensor if it is found to be faulty, repairing any damaged wiring or connectors, and clearing the code with a diagnostic scanner.

7. Is it possible to reset OBDII code C1416 on a 2018 Toyota RAV4 without fixing the issue?

While you can clear the code temporarily with a diagnostic scanner, it is crucial to address the root cause of the problem to prevent the code from reoccurring.

8. Can extreme weather conditions trigger OBDII code C1416 on a 2018 Toyota RAV4?

Extreme weather conditions such as heavy rain or snow can potentially affect the rear speed sensor's performance and trigger code C1416 in a 2018 Toyota RAV4.

9. How much does it cost to repair OBDII code C1416 on a 2018 Toyota RAV4?

The cost of repairing code C1416 can vary depending on the extent of the issue, but it typically involves the cost of a new speed sensor and any necessary labor charges.

10. Will OBDII code C1416 prevent my 2018 Toyota RAV4 from passing a state inspection?

Yes, code C1416 may prevent your 2018 Toyota RAV4 from passing a state inspection, as it indicates a malfunction in the vehicle's anti-lock braking system that can impact safety and performance.
